Cricket Australia have spent the last few years trashing their one day internationals and now its reached the point that free to air broadcasters don't want to show them at current asking prices
Cricket Australia has scheduled way too many 50 over internationals the last few years when the rest of the world now plays more 20 over internationals than 50 overs. Then they trashed their 20 over internationals by only selecting a B side to play the 20 over games (as the test players were always booked to play an overseas test tour)
End result is all their one day internationals became 2nd rate entertainment and now no free to air broadcaster wants them
Cricket generally schedule way too many meaningless internationals anyways and maybe this will be a first step to reducing an overcrowded cricket schedule
